HR Generalist

Summary

The HR Generalist is responsible for all functions related to recruiting and onboarding. This position involves planning and coordinating effective recruitment strategies with program managers and other stakeholders. It also handles employee relations, labor relations, benefits, staff development, compliance, and employee recognition. This is a confidential position assisting the Executive Director of Human Resources with labor negotiations and collective bargaining agreement interpretation.

This role requires extensive interaction via phone, email, virtual, and in-person methods with applicants and internal customers. It demands the use of technology for efficient task completion, including intermediate knowledge of Microsoft Office products, PeopleSoft, and other business systems. Essential Functions & Other Duties

Essential Job Duties

  • Provide excellent customer service to all employees, colleagues, and customers.
  • Manage full-cycle recruitment activities for specific departments, from requisition to hire.
  • Collaborate with the Executive Director of HR, DEI Officer, department managers, and supervisors to develop effective recruitment strategies.
  • Ensure equitability by reviewing and revising job duties, qualifications, knowledge, skills, and abilities; create recruitment tools including job announcements and descriptions.
  • Monitor and ensure compliance with college, local, state, and federal regulations in recruitment and hiring.
  • Provide training to managers and supervisors on hiring processes, procedures, and legal requirements.
  • Answer inquiries from management, employees, and applicants on recruitment processes.
  • Collect, verify, and analyze data (e.g., recruitment, hiring, turnover ratios) and create reports for the Executive Director of HR.
  • Oversee the new employee orientation process in conjunction with other HR staff.
  • Provide interpretation, information, and advice regarding college policies, procedures, collective bargaining agreements, and state/federal rules.
  • Assist in developing and documenting HR practices, policies, procedures, training materials, and communication tools for compliance.
  • Handle PeopleSoft compliance, including data cleansing, process mapping, and workshop participation.
  • Complete desk audits, peer reviews, reclassifications, and job description updates.
  • Conduct job analysis and desk audits for proper classification per collective bargaining agreements and FLSA.
  • Assist employees with FMLA, PFML, L&I claims, and ADA accommodation requests, including tracking and follow-up.
  • Manage employee relations, labor relations, benefits, staff development, compliance, and employee recognition as assigned.
  • Maintain confidentiality and security of HR and Payroll information.
  • Conduct employee investigations as needed.
  • Provide mentorship and guidance to the HR Team.

Available Benefits to Eligible Employees

As a higher education employee, you and your qualified family members are eligible for benefits including medical, dental, life insurance, retirement, and long-term disability.

Medical/Dental Plans

Employees pay a portion of medical costs; dental coverage is provided at no cost with options like Uniform Dental Plan, DeltaCare, and Willamette Dental. Vision plans include Davis Vision by MetLife, EyeMed, and MetLife Vision.

Retirement Plans

Faculty and Exempt Positions: Choose between SBRP (TIAA) or TRS/PERS Plan 3. Classified Positions: Choose between PERS Plan 2 or Plan 3.

Term Life Insurance

Basic life insurance of $35,000 and $5,000 accidental death and dismemberment at no cost; additional optional coverage available.

Long Term Disability Insurance

Basic plan at no cost; optional plan pays 60% of salary.

Other Optional Benefits

Includes AFLAC, Flexible Spending Arrangement, Voluntary Employees' Beneficiary Association, Short-Term Disability, Employees Assistance Program, Guaranteed Education Tuition, Deferred Compensation, and more.

Leaves and Holidays

Vacation, sick leave, holidays (e.g., Independence Day, Labor Day), personal leave, and family leave are available based on employee status.
